Deciphering the Multiplication: Why Multipliers Matter

Score multipliers are numerical factors applied to a base score, amplifying the points earned for actions within a match. These can be found in various forms—streaks, environmental bonuses, or power-up effects. Their strategic use often determines whether a player can surpass competitive thresholds or set new personal bests.

Most multiplayer and speedrun communities leverage a complex architecture of multipliers. Notably, some systems employ what are termed additive multipliers versus multiplicative multipliers.

Understanding the distinction between additive and multiplicative systems is essential for crafting optimal strategies, especially when multiple bonuses interact.

Types of Score Multipliers: Additive vs. Multiplicative

Type Mechanism Effect Example
Additive Multipliers Sum of individual bonuses applied to the base score Linearly increases total points Completing a level with +10% bonus, +5% bonus, etc., summed before application
Multiplicative Multipliers Bonuses multiply together for exponential growth Results in a compounded effect that can grow rapidly Applying 10x and 2x bonuses together yields 20x total if multiplicative

Implications for Player Strategy and System Design

From a design perspective, distinguishing between additive and multiplicative bonuses creates different player incentives. Additive bonuses tend to encourage stacking minor advantages, while multiplicative bonuses reward executing high-stakes plays or perfect runs.

Effective mastery of these systems can lead to higher score ceilings, more engaging gameplay, and ultimately, a more competitive environment. Developers, aware of these dynamics, often balance bonus mechanics to prevent runaway scoring, ensuring competitive fairness and long-term player engagement.
